Abstract
Through a comparative analysis of three encapsulation technology related to the EOS, namely LAPS, PPP, GFP, this paper discusses the advantages of the encapsulated Ethernet data by GFP protocol and the implementation of the Ethernet frame GFP mapping into SDH protocols based on Xilinx’s Virtex-6 FPGA.
